Positives:
Map feels large and varied.
Terraforming feels good - meaningful changes such as opening new areas, flooding areas, letting you breathe longer, etc.
Areas are locked at the beginning so you can't explore everything at once.
Progression unlocks in the first half of the game feel like game changers (base building / progression / unlocks).
World reacts not only to the base stats, but to what you put down as far as trees / animals / etc.
Exploring story locations felt interesting and exciting.
Endings have been adjusted and feel much more appropriate than they did before.

Negatives:
The game map is swiss cheese - I'd regularly clip out of the map to see how things were working or to see what's past the next ice block. It rarely took more than a minute to find a way to do so.
Mid-game requires a lot of storage management.
Automation needs a 'this thing can demand at level X, but if something of higher tier is demanding it should supply it' intermediary storage solution.
I feel like the edge areas (the sand waterfall, the southern beach, the desert) didn't get much love during development. Basic resources, no real landmarks - I never found much reason to have remote bases.
Replaying in new starting locations matters exactly up until the ice melts separating the two halves of the map.
You need a *lot* of every single one of the final tier things to finish the game, it felt like.
Insects and frogs show up around the world after you raise them - I wish creatures did, too.

The Verdict:
I liked it, especially in the first half. Admitted, I actually had as much fun clipping out of the world and Skyrimming with jetpack shenanigans as I did actually hauling materials around. That said, the final bit of actually getting from 2 to 5 TTi may not be worth it to actually finish the game once you've followed the various storylines, explored all the biomes, gotten to the Animals stage and crafted yourself a few species.
